After the telecom thunder and the retail rush in India, Healthcare seems to be the next biggest bet for everyone. With promises of many billions of Indian Rupees, large diversified conglomerates such as Reliance, Birlas, Tatas are all betting their money in the Indian healthcare delivery space. As has been with other high growth sectors in India that witnessed a rapid meteoric rise, those who don?t jump into the bandwagon quickly are likely to miss the speeding bus completely. Industry experts promise that among other businesses which will ride the crest of this healthcare delivery boom will be the erstwhile non-starter business of healthcare communications.

Many communication giants who were early starters in healthcare communications (having started two to three years ago) in India had to face the embarrassing ignominy of their businesses not taking off despite repeated attempts at survival. Some continue to struggle, but on the whole, it would be safe to say that most have been decimated by being ahead of their time. Some continue to adorn the garb of existing as healthcare communications agencies on the face of it, but beneath the surface their survival instincts have taken the better of them and they are doing all but healthcare communications while waiting for the elusive critical mass of clients.

But today, after the many months of vacillation and intemperate behaviour, the healthcare sector are finally going to go the way of the ?boom? sectors. But before entering this field do not forget to read the warning sign which proclaims, ?Enter at your own risk. Blink and the race will be over?.

Today?s signs that show the glimpse of a different tomorrow. Lets take a look at the signs - Reuters has projected 2007 to have the highest year-on-year earnings growth, medical tourism has grown ten-fold from 2000 to have over 1,00,000 medical tourists touching the shores of India, private equity funding is finding its way into the healthcare sector, healthcare insurance has also taken off and finally the clincher probably is the coming together of the tipping point ?influentials? ? the big Indian conglomerates investing big money in healthcare, are making the sector impossible to ignore.

So, the healthcare sector will grow at a frenetic pace - Quod Erat Demonstrandum!. Coming to the need for good communications companies in this field and why they will grow is as self-evident as it is when we see the tree in a good seed after adding in the factors of the right conditions, right nutrients and a little luck.

This need for specialized communications in the healthcare field is particularly important in a country with a tropical climate profile as in India. Sadly the climate makes India a breeding ground for diseases. Therefore, as much as we don't want it to happen, there will be many manifestations of many diseases(a few of them which have even been eradicated from the rest of the world!)

Secondly, we live in a country where traditionally we have been taught not to question the medical professional; where a question by the traditional patient may even border on being branded as a taboo. The need for educating the huge and myriad Indian population in many ways will be an imperative difficult to ignore.

Then, the very nature of India?s diversity calls for an effective communications scenario. Last known to have 1652 dialects of which 24 languages are spoken by over a million people, a mosaic made of thousands of cultural nuances that necessitate an intricate understanding of regional needs before communications can be effective. Also, healthcare is an area of special interest and communicating the needs, dispelling the myths and clearing the misconceptions in this field will assume sigificant proportions.

The barometer signs all indicate towards a high growth in the healthcare communications space, and those who have an advantage of local knowledge, understanding of healthcare and efficacy of implementation, will benefit enormously by riding the current healthcare crest.

What is MS?

MS is an autoimmune disease in which the body's defensive immune system attacks and destroys the fatty tissue, the myelin surrounding nerves in the brain and spinal cord. These myelin sheaths perform the same function as insulation around an electrical wire. Without the myelin insulation, nerve impulses from brain to body can short out and become confused, misdirected, or be completely blocked. Symptoms can include numbness and/or tingling in the extremities, weakness, lack of coordination and/or balance, gait difficulties, slurring of speech, blurred or double vision, bowel and bladder dysfunction, vertigo, and heat intolerance.

While no one knows for certain why some people get MS, there is some speculation to its cause. Because those who have family members with MS are at a slightly increased risk, there is speculation that it may be somewhat genetic. There also seems to be a link between where a person lived as a child and getting the disease as an adult. Those who grew up in colder climates, farther from the equator than other geographical locations are more likely to get it, suggesting that it may possess an environmental link. The risk also increases for those people who are of Western European ancestry. And, along these lines, the risk is greatly higher for women than men, with MS infecting three times more females than males.

General HealthColon Healthy Recipes And Foods For Meals


Having a healthy colon is the key to long term health and finding good colon healthy recipes is one way to help keep your body healthy. While it might be difficult to actually locate recipes that are labeled to be healthy for the colon, you can learn to recognize them by the ingredients that they contain- namely fresh fruits and vegetables. In addition, a healthy recipe will contain little or no white flour and white sugar. Perhaps the best recipe for colon health, however is to include lots of fruits and vegetables in your meals as described below.

The large intestine or colon is where the results of the entire digestive process gather up to leave the body. Due to poor eating habits, most people have an unhealthy colon resulting in constipation. If your colon is not in tip top shape, food can get trapped in the lining and start to rot. It can also become hardened in there and can even be trapped in your colon for years!

Of course, food plays a big role in the health of your colon. There are many arguments for the pros and cons of a vegan diet, however when it comes to colon health, a vegetarian way of eating has many benefits.

Animal foods are hard to digest where plant foods are quite easy to digest. So, colon healthy recipes will include little or no animal foods and be based mainly on whole grains, fruits and vegetables. In addition to good colon health, using recipes made with these foods will have a pronounced effect on your overall health in general.

Vegetables and fruits are very colon friendly and can be processed or digested quite easily by the body. They contain a variety of vitamins and minerals as well as enzymes and fiber- all things that are essential to good health. Fiber, in particular, is good for your colon health as it adds bulk which helps to pass the food along the digestive tract.

One simple and easy breakfast recipe could be a fruit salad with oatmeal (not the packaged or instant stuff). Natural fruit juice can be quite healthy too although it does not have fiber and drinking a lot of water will help with the digestive process.

Always try to include a salad for lunch with lots of dark leafy greens. Stay away from the iceburg and try to include romaine lettuce and spinach as these have more vitamins. Broccoli, carrots, cauliflower and kale are great additions to any salad. Don?t forget the olives and artichokes for a little zest. Instead of bottled dressing which is probably loaded with sugar, try olive oil and vinegar- you might even mix in some fresh herbs and create your own salad dressing recipe!

For snacks, stay away from anything that comes in a package and go for raw nuts, fruit, veggies or even a nice fruit smoothie- made with real fresh fruit, of course! If you need something crunchy try spreading all natural peanut butter on celery (this can also help to satisfy any cravings for sweets).

Colon healthy recipes for dinner follow the same common sense rules. Try cutting down on the red meat and eating fresh fish along with a salad and perhaps some steamed broccoli, zucchini and carrots. If you need something more substantial try adding brown rice, corn on the cob or potatoes.

Just like with any other aspect of your health, eating nutritious healthy foods is a sure fire way to keep your colon, and your whole body, in good health.
